
Uzbek defender Abdukodir Khusanov arrived in Manchester together with his representative, Ulyqbek Asanbayev, as reported by Telecomasia.net.
The 20-year-old footballer has signed a contract with the British club and will wear the number 45 jersey. Manchester City’s head coach, Pep Guardiola, was also present at the signing, showing personal interest in Khusanov's transfer.
According to media reports, Manchester City will pay over 40 million euros for the transfer of the Uzbekistan national team defender.
Khusanov previously played for the Belarusian side Energetik-BGU before moving to Lens. During his time with the French club, he participated in 31 matches and provided one assist. His agreement with Lens is valid until June 2027, and Transfermarkt values him at approximately 12 million euros.
